What does Acadian Asset Management do? Business model and key facts
Get the full picture of Acadian Asset Management: what it builds, where it operates, and how it makes money.
Sector: Financial Services
Industry: Asset Management
Employees (FY): 396
Acadian Asset Management, Inc. functions as a holding entity that primarily offers asset management services. The company's operations are structured around its "Quant and Solutions" segment. This division applies a sophisticated, data-driven investment approach, leveraging advanced technology in a computational, factor-based process. This methodology is deployed across a broad spectrum of asset classes and geographical areas, encompassing global, international (non-U.S.), and emerging market equities, alongside managed volatility strategies and various multi-asset financial products. Established in 1980, the firm's main offices are situated in Boston, Massachusetts.
